The elite eight are what I posted in your other thread T206 "T206 Carl Lundgren Chicago Back question". They are 150-350 Group Subjects, but appear to be short printed with the Piedmont 350 back. They are:

Dahlen Boston
Ewing
Ganley
Tom Jones St Louis
Karger
Lindaman
Lundgren Chicago
Mullin Horizontal

However, as Ted responded in that same thread, the Elite Eight have now become the Ninja Nine with the finding of Schulte Front View with a P350 back. Previously it was thought that this card was in the 150 Only Group Subjects.

Just to clarify a little, the (formerly) "elite eight" subjects were so designated because they were believed to be the only eight 150/350 subjects that could only be found in the 350 series with the Piedmont 350 back and EPDG. That is, these subjects alone among the 150/350 subjects were thought to be available with the Piedmont 350 back but no other "350 subjects" back (e.g., Sweet Caporal 350 and Sovereign 350). What's more, they are more difficult to find with the Piedmont 350 back than are other 150/350 subjects.

Now that a single copy of Schulte (Front View) with Piedmont 350 has been confirmed, the "elite eight" have morphed into the "notable nine" (I'm personally not a big fan of "ninja nine").

Will any of the remaining 150-only subjects someday surface with a Piedmont 350 back and transform this list into the "tremendous ten"? I doubt it, but time will tell.

For T206 collectors that like to get into the "nitty-gritty" of front / back combos, here again are the elite 8 subjects.


[linked image]


Originally, when I coined this term several years ago, it included Lundgren (Chicago). However, this 1st series Carl Lundgren card is in a class of its own
in the "hierarchy" of the T206's. This T206 subject was printed with ony 3 different tobacco backs (see post #19 here). The short-printing of Lundgren
was most likely due to his Major League career ending April 23, 1909.

So, I have replaced Lundgren with the Schulte (front view) card in order to be consistent with the other 7 subjects in this group. All eight of these sub-
jects can be found with PIEDMONT 150, SOVEREIGN 150, SWEET CAPORAL 150, and the Brown HINDU backs. The Ewing and Tom Jones cards are also
found with the SWEET CAPORAL 150, Factory 649 overprint.

Very rarely will these 8 cards be found with a PIEDMONT 350 back. And, they were not printed with SOVEREIGN 350, nor SWEET CAPORAL 350 backs.
Furthermore, 7 of these subjects are found with the El Principe de Gales back (EPDG)....but, this a very rare occurence. The Schulte card has yet to
be confirmed with the EPDG back.
